While both roles require solid electrical fundamentals, an Electrical Design Engineer focuses more on blueprinting and system-level integration of control panels. In contrast, a general Electrical Engineer may engage more broadly in project execution, troubleshooting, and client support across diverse applications.
New graduates should prioritize gaining experience with industrial control systems and UL508A standards. Engaging with mentorship opportunities and pursuing relevant certifications can fast-track advancement, especially within firms emphasizing mechanical and electrical design collaborations.
Daily tasks often involve diagnosing system faults, programming control software, and collaborating with multidisciplinary teams. Engineers must navigate strict safety standards while tailoring solutions to unique industry requirements like food processing or water treatment facilities.

Electrical Engineers in Fairfax typically earn between $75,000 and $95,000 annually, depending on experience, certifications, and industry specialization. Contract-to-hire roles may offer competitive hourly rates with potential for permanent placement and benefits.
